ZIZ News…Jan 27 2012 – Deputy Headmaster at the Gingerland Secondary School. Mr. Shefton Liburd on Thursday indicated that preparations are well on the way for the upcoming annual sports meet for the school slated for February 28th. “The houses are already having meetings and they are already getting ‘pepped’ up. We have already had the orientation walk for the cross country events which is used to synthesize the new students as to the proper course for their particular race,’ he said.

He noted that the heats exercises for the long jump and high jump will commence on Monday 30th. January and further indicated that the early annual sports meet of February 28th is part of the plan to get a team selected for the inter High school championship in St. Kitts, so that they can commence early training as a team. This he believes will positively impact their overall performance this year.

The exciting cross country events will be held on one day—February 16th with both juniors and seniors in both sexes having their runs starting at about 9 am and concluding during the afternoon.

The much anticipated Teachers’ Cross country race, which attracted quite some attention, last year, is slated for February 16th. Headmistress Dawn Jeffers is expected to be at the starting line.
